Dennis Purpura is a 30-year veteran of the enterprise software and telecommunications industries where he has held senior sales and marketing executive assignments with Fair Isaac & Company, IBM's Financial Institution Call Center Automation Software and Professional Services sales in North America, Teknekron Software Alliance Core Banking Systems, and Tymnet, a data communications subsidiary of McDonnell Douglas Corporation.
Dennis has significant experience working and living in East and Southeast Asia. He successfully launched a software and consulting services business for Teknekron based in Malaysia and led the turn around of Control Data Corporation's hosted services business in Tokyo.
He entered executive search when he joined Heidrick & Struggles' Silicon Valley Technology and Communications Practice. Because of his Asia experience, he also served as their North America liaison with the Asia Pacific Technology Group. More recently, Dennis was a partner at Nucleus Partners/LGES; a Silicon-Valley based strategic consulting and executive recruiting firm.
Dennis is an active member of Community Presbyterian Church in Danville where he served as elder and currently works with inner city missions. He was a founder and the Chairman of Capernaum Friendship Young Life, an outreach program for mentally and physically challenged children and young adults in the Diablo Valley of Contra Costa County. He is an Adjunct Professor of Business at Patten University in Oakland where he lectures on Managerial Finance and Organizational and Business Development.
Dennis holds Bachelors of Science and MBA degrees from the University of Southern California where he was also awarded scholarships, scholastic awards and a full fellowship to graduate school. While living in Tokyo, Japan he completed the Business Executive Studies program at Sophia University.
A Viet Nam era veteran, Dennis served in the United States Air Force and attended college on the GI Bill.
